Police Officer Richard Mason Hyche

Police Officer Richard Mason Hyche

EOW: Oct 15, 1975

Police Officer Richard Hyche was shot and killed from ambush by a man with a rifle in the area of 916 Deodar Street.

An off-duty officer had spotted the man, who was wanted for murder, walking along I-10. When backup officers arrived they came under fire from the man who had made it to an apartment complex. When Officer Hyche arrived on the scene he stopped to ask a grounds person for information. As he was doing so the man shot him from the corner of one of the buildings. The suspect was eventually apprehended and convicted of Officer Hyche’s murder. The suspect was sentenced to life-imprisonment in San Quentin.

Officer Hyche had served with the Ontario Police Department for four years and had previously served with the San Bernardino County Sheriff’s Office for two years. He was survived by his wife and three children.
